Waterburg Safaris was founded by Thula Manzini, a qualified professional and licensed Safari/ Tour Guide. Born and bred in Ntabazinduna Communal lands next to Bulawayo in Zimbabwe, and coming form grassroots of being a herdboy, Thula joined the hospitality industry, initially as a grounds man/ gardener, became waiter, barman; eventually becoming the Food and Beverage Manager and later Operations Tour Guide when he switched over to travel business. Thula’s passion to become a safari guide was ignited by the beautifully coloured birds that he used to see when doing his garden duties at a luxury camp where he was employed. In one evening he was found by the Chief Guide showing and explaining to resident clients some of these birds. The Chief Guide then invited him to explain more about what he has observed on these birds. Whilst Thula did not know what the name of these birds were in English but in local language, it is the way he explained about them that he was immediately invited by the Chief Guide to train as a safari guide and since then he has never looked back.
 His passion for the wildlife coupled with the sense of adventure and enthusiasm for eco-tourism then persuaded him to cross from the hospitality sector to safari and travel business. Thula’s immense knowledge of the region, passion for wildlife and natural landscapes, spiced with his love for the rich divergent cultures and history makes him the ideal person to guide you through any Southern African safari trip.

 

Most Memorable Moments on Tour
Witnessing a pride of 21 lions pulling down 2 buffalos and a calf in Hwange National Park in Zimbabwe- breath taking sighting.
When I saw 3 leopards together in Sankuyo Community Trust land in the Khwai region adjacent to Moremi Game Reserve in Botswana- one of the rare occasions.

 

Garland Mommsen
Based in Cape Town in South Africa, Garland is the core Director of Waterburg Safaris. He is a qualified field guide with vast experience of Southern Africa having traveled extensively as Field Guide to such countries as Namibia, Botswana, Zimbabwe, Zambia, Swaziland, Lesotho, Malawi and Mozambique.
Experience: He has been working in Southern Africa for more than a decade and has developed a true passion for Africa, its people and the wildlife!
Favourite African Destination: I love all the countries I work in as each country has something special! If I would have to choose one then I would have to say Namibia because of its sheer beauty and contrast and the warmth of the locals!
Most memorable moment on tour:  I was on tour through Namibia with a group of 6 clients. The day was a very hot one in the Etosha Game Reserve in the Northern Part of Namibia. We were watching a pride of lions at a waterhole called Leeubron and seeing that the sun was about to set we had to make our way back to our rest camp, Okaukuejo. The lion sighting on its own was a sight to remember but on our way back, the sky turned bright orange from the reflection on the dust particles in the sky. Far off in the distance we saw a commotion - only to discover that it was a group of black jackals of about 15 individuals eating a springbuck. This might sound savage but the contrasting colours and very unusual sighting brought back home both the harshness and beauty of this wonderful continent I work on.
